Steps to Conduct Research: A Comprehensive Guide

Conducting research is a systematic process that involves several key steps to ensure the collection, analysis, and interpretation of data are thorough and accurate. This guide outlines the essential stages involved in conducting effective research.

1. Identify the Research Problem

The first step in any research process is to clearly define the problem or question you aim to address. This involves identifying a gap in existing knowledge or a specific issue that needs exploration. A well-defined research problem is crucial, as it guides the direction of your entire study.

Tips:

  • Ensure that the problem is specific, manageable, and relevant.
  • Conduct a preliminary review of existing literature to refine the problem.

2. Conduct a Literature Review

A literature review involves reviewing existing research related to your topic. This helps to understand the current state of knowledge, identify gaps, and frame your research within the context of what is already known.

Steps in Literature Review:

  • Search for Sources: Use academic databases, libraries, and online resources to find relevant articles, books, and other publications.
  • Review and Summarize: Evaluate the credibility and relevance of each source. Summarize key findings and theories.
  • Synthesize Information: Identify patterns, themes, and gaps in the literature to inform your research approach.

3. Formulate a Hypothesis or Research Question

Based on your literature review, you should formulate a hypothesis or a specific research question. A hypothesis is a testable prediction about the relationship between variables, while a research question is a clear, focused question that your study aims to answer.

Tips:

  • Ensure the hypothesis or research question is clear, specific, and researchable.
  • Consider how your research will contribute new insights or solutions.

4. Design the Research Methodology

Research methodology is the framework for how you will conduct your study. This includes selecting a research design, determining data collection methods, and outlining procedures.

Research Design:

  • Qualitative: Focuses on exploring phenomena through interviews, observations, and case studies.
  • Quantitative: Involves statistical analysis and experiments to quantify variables and test hypotheses.
  • Mixed Methods: Combines both qualitative and quantitative approaches.

Data Collection Methods:

  • Surveys and Questionnaires: Useful for gathering large amounts of data from a population.
  • Interviews: Provide in-depth insights through direct questioning.
  • Experiments: Test hypotheses under controlled conditions.
  • Observations: Collect data based on direct observation of phenomena.

Tips:

  • Choose methods that align with your research objectives and are practical within your constraints.
  • Ensure your methods are ethical and protect participants’ rights.

5. Collect Data

Once your research design is finalized, you can begin data collection. This step involves gathering information according to your chosen methods and ensuring that data is recorded accurately.

Tips:

  • Maintain consistency and accuracy in data collection.
  • Ensure data is collected in a manner that is ethical and respects participants’ privacy.

6. Analyze Data

Data analysis involves processing and interpreting the collected data to draw meaningful conclusions. The method of analysis depends on whether your data is qualitative or quantitative.

Qualitative Analysis:

  • Coding: Categorize data into themes or patterns.
  • Thematic Analysis: Identify and analyze themes across data sets.

Quantitative Analysis:

  • Statistical Analysis: Use statistical tools and software to analyze numerical data.
  • Descriptive Statistics: Summarize data using measures like mean, median, and standard deviation.
  • Inferential Statistics: Test hypotheses and make predictions based on data.

Tips:

  • Ensure your analysis is thorough and aligns with your research objectives.
  • Use appropriate software tools for analyzing complex data sets.

7. Interpret and Discuss Findings

Interpretation involves making sense of your data analysis results in the context of your research question or hypothesis. Discuss how your findings relate to existing literature, and explore their implications.

Tips:

  • Relate your findings to the original research problem and hypothesis.
  • Consider limitations and potential sources of error in your study.

8. Draw Conclusions and Make Recommendations

Based on your findings, draw conclusions that address your research question or hypothesis. Make recommendations for future research or practical applications based on your results.

Tips:

  • Ensure conclusions are supported by your data and analysis.
  • Provide actionable recommendations that can be applied in practice or further research.

9. Write the Research Report

The final step is to compile your research into a comprehensive report. A well-written research report communicates your findings clearly and effectively.

Report Structure:

  • Title Page: Includes the title, author, and institution.
  • Abstract: A brief summary of the research problem, methods, findings, and conclusions.
  • Introduction: Describes the research problem, objectives, and significance.
  • Literature Review: Summarizes relevant literature and identifies research gaps.
  • Methodology: Details the research design, data collection, and analysis methods.
  • Results: Presents the findings of your research.
  • Discussion: Interprets the results and discusses their implications.
  • Conclusion: Summarizes key findings and recommendations.
  • References: Lists all sources cited in your report.
  • Appendices: Includes supplementary materials, such as data tables or questionnaires.

Tips:

  • Write clearly and concisely, avoiding jargon.
  • Ensure proper citation of sources and adherence to academic standards.

10. Review and Revise

Before finalizing your research report, review and revise it to ensure accuracy, coherence, and completeness. Seek feedback from peers or mentors to improve the quality of your report.

Tips:

  • Proofread for grammatical and typographical errors.
  • Check that all sections are complete and logically organized.
